  1. I am Amos. And I raised sheep near the town of Tekoa when Uzziah was king of Judah and Jeroboam son of Jehoash was king of Israel. Two years before the earthquake, the Lord gave me several messages about Israel,
  2. and I said: When the Lord roars from Jerusalem, pasturelands and Mount Carmel dry up and turn brown.
  3. Judgment on Syria

    The Lord said: I will punish Syria for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They dragged logs with spikes over the people of Gilead.
  4. I will break through the gates of Damascus. I will destroy the people of Wicked Valley and the ruler of Beth-Eden. Then the Syrians will be dragged as prisoners to Kir. I, the Lord, have spoken!
  5. Judgment on Philistia

    The Lord said: I will punish Philistia for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They dragged off my people from town after town to sell them as slaves to the Edomites.
  6. I will destroy the king of Ashdod and the ruler of Ashkelon. I will strike down Ekron, and that will be the end of the Philistines. I, the Lord, have spoken!
  7. Judgment on Phoenicia

    The Lord said: I will punish Phoenicia for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They broke their treaty and dragged off my people from town after town to sell them as slaves to the Edomites.
  8. That's why I will send flames to burn down the city of Tyre along with its fortresses.
  9. Judgment on Edom

    The Lord said: I will punish Edom for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They killed their own relatives and were so terribly furious that they showed no mercy.
  10. Now I will send fire to wipe out the fortresses of Teman and Bozrah.
  11. Judgment on Ammon

    The Lord said: I will punish Ammon for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. In Gilead they ripped open pregnant women, just to take the land.
  12. Now I will send fire to destroy the walls and fortresses of Rabbah. Enemies will shout and attack like a whirlwind.
  13. Ammon's king and leaders will be dragged away. I, the Lord, have spoken!
  14. Judgment on Moab

    The Lord said: I will punish Moab for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They made lime from the bones of the king of Edom.
  15. Now I will send fire to destroy the fortresses of Kerioth. Battle shouts and trumpet blasts will be heard as I destroy Moab
  16. with its king and leaders. I, the Lord, have spoken!
  17. Judgment on Judah

    The Lord said: I will punish Judah for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They have rejected my teachings and refused to obey me. They were led astray by the same false gods their ancestors worshiped.
  18. Now I will send fire on Judah and destroy the fortresses of Jerusalem.
  19. Judgment on Israel

    The Lord said: I will punish Israel for countless crimes, and I won't change my mind. They sell honest people for money, and the needy are sold for the price of sandals.
  20. They smear the poor in the dirt and push aside those who are helpless. My holy name is dishonored, because fathers and sons sleep with the same young women.
  21. They lie down beside altars on clothes taken as security for loans. And they drink wine in my temple, wine bought with the money they received from fines.
  22. Israel, the Amorites were there when you entered Canaan. They were tall as cedars and strong as oaks. But I wiped them out— I destroyed their branches and their roots.
  23. I chose some of you to be prophets and others to be Nazirites. People of Israel, you know this is true. I, the Lord, have spoken!
  24. But you commanded the prophets not to speak their message, and you pressured the Nazirites into drinking wine.
  25. And so I will crush you, just as a wagon full of grain crushes the ground.
